Happy Birthday Valentina Paloma Pinault. You are now 1 year old!

Name: Valentina Paloma Pinault

Birthday: September 21st, 2007

Famous for: Valentina is famous for being the daughter of actress Salma Hayek and her former fiancé, PPR CEO François-Henri Pinault.
